If you're thinking of buying a treadmill used for sale there are some points to be considered before making a final decision. Be sure that the treadmill for sale near me is clean and in a good condition. Look for any documentation such as the receipt or warranty and find out what maintenance is required to keep the machine in good working order. If you are unable to locate any paperwork, do some quick internet research to see the prices similar models were sold for in the past.

You should also consider the age of the treadmill that you are thinking about. In general, newer models have more advanced features. Newer models are also more compatible with replacement parts. If you're going to buy a used treadmill near me, try to choose models that are less than five years old.

Finally, remember to test the treadmill before you purchase it. If you can get an idea of how well it works by looking at its exterior make sure you take it for a test run also. This is your chance to become a treadmill detective and collect vital clues about its quality and condition.

A good way to test the treadmill's performance is to put your finger on the belt, just above the deck. If you feel any scratches, scoring or raised sections on the belt, it is likely that the deck has worn out. It's also a good idea to check the motor for any signs of overheating. If the motor is experiencing problems, it's likely to require replacement also.

When negotiating with a seller it is essential to start low and be flexible in the initial offer. If a seller isn't willing to negotiate on the price, they should think about other alternatives.

Although buying a used treadmill is less expensive, it's important to remember that it's not as reliable as a brand new model. When looking for a used treadmill, people should be aware that it's possible that the treadmill could fail or require repairs within the first few months or even weeks of usage. This is particularly true when buying an older treadmill.

A used treadmill may not be covered under the warranty originally issued. The majority of treadmill manufacturers won't transfer their warranty from the original to a secondhand buyer therefore it is crucial to inquire about this prior to making a purchase.

In addition to marketplaces online, it's an excellent idea to look into used sporting goods stores that specialize in selling products such as treadmills. While these types of stores don't usually sell as cheaply as marketplaces online, they do generally offer better warranties and return policies.

mobvoi-home-treadmill-pro-foldable-treadmill-for-home-compatible-with-smartwatches-virtual-training-trails-running-and-walking-workout-modes-bluetooth-speaker-remote-control-fitness-exercise-10.jpgWhen it's time to move your treadmill, follow the instructions in the owner's guide. Remove the treadmill from the power cord, fold the belt up at a 45-degree angle, and secure it before tipping it onto the wheels. Depending on how heavy it is it may be beneficial to have someone else assist you with the tipping process in order to prevent it from becoming unstable or falling over. Once it's in its new home, unfold it and connect it again. It's recommended to test it at a slower speed to ensure that everything is working properly.
